debian

Debian lsnrctl如何重启

小樊
42
2025-08-19 03:58:45
栏目: 智能运维

在 Debian 系统中,lsnrctl 是 Oracle 数据库监听器的命令行工具。要重启 Oracle 数据库监听器,可以使用以下步骤:

  1. 打开终端:首先,确保你有权限访问终端,并且已经登录到你的 Debian 系统。

  2. 以 Oracle 用户身份登录:通常需要以具有适当权限的 Oracle 用户身份登录,因为 lsnrctl 是 Oracle 软件的一部分。你可以使用 susudo 命令切换到 Oracle 用户。例如:

    su - oracle
    

    或者如果你有 sudo 权限:

    sudo -i -u oracle
    
  3. 运行 lsnrctl 命令:使用 lsnrctl 命令来停止和启动监听器。你可以使用以下命令:

    lsnrctl stop
    lsnrctl start
    

    或者你可以使用 restart 命令来一步到位:

    lsnrctl restart
    
  4. 验证监听器状态:重启后,你可以使用以下命令来验证监听器的状态,确保它正在运行:

    lsnrctl status
    

请注意,执行这些操作可能需要 Oracle 环境变量(如 ORACLE_HOMEPATH)已正确设置。如果你遇到任何问题,请确保这些环境变量已正确配置。

0
看了该问题的人还看了